Chocolate Mascarpone Pound Cake

Ingredients

    For The Cake:

  • Butter (for the pan)
  • Flour (for the pan)
  • 1 16-ounce box of pound cake mix, such as Betty Crocker
  • 1 cup unsweetened cocoa powder (such as Hershey's)
  • 4 tablespoons ½ stick unsalted butter, at room temperature
  • ¼ cup 2 ounces mascarpone cheese, at room temperature
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• 3 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 2 large eggs (at room temperature)
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
  • For The Glaze:

  • 1½ cups confectioners' sugar
  • ¼ cup unsweetened cocoa powder (such as Hershey)
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ract

Instructions

    For the cake:

    1. Place an oven rack in the center of the oven. Preheat the oven to 350°F. Butter and flour a 9 x 5-inch metal loaf pan.
    2. In a large bowl, combine the pound cake mix, cocoa powder, butter, mascarpone cheese, milk,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la extract. Using an electric mixer, beat on low speed for 30 seconds. Increase the speed to medium and beat for 2 minutes until smooth and thick. Pour the batter into the prepared pan.
    3. Bake for 50 to 55 minutes, until a cake tester inserted into the middle of the cake comes out clean. Cool for 10 minutes and invert onto a rack to cool completely, about 1 hour.

    For the glaze:

    1. In a small bowl, whisk together the sugar and cocoa powder. Add the vanilla and slowly whisk in 3 tablespoons water, or a little more as needed, until the mixture is thick. Spoon the glaze over the cake and serve.
